The ideal candidate and valued member of our team will be responsible for planning, designing, and quoting for clients' projects in line with Haddonstone's company policy.
Responsibilities:
- Run your own projects
- Update relevant team members on the project progress
Qualifications:
- Strong verbal, written, and organizational skills
We provide all necessary training.

How to prepare for a job interview at Haddonstone Ltd
✨Know Your Projects
Before the interview, brush up on project management principles and be ready to discuss any relevant projects you've worked on. Think about how you planned, designed, and quoted for these projects, as this will show your understanding of the role.
✨Communicate Clearly
Since strong verbal and written skills are crucial, practice articulating your thoughts clearly. You might want to prepare a few examples of how you've effectively communicated project updates or collaborated with team members in the past.
✨Show Your Organisational Skills
Be prepared to discuss how you manage your time and keep projects on track. Bring examples of tools or methods you use to stay organised, as this will demonstrate your ability to run your own projects efficiently.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, have a few thoughtful questions ready about the company’s project management processes or team dynamics.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you.
